Memorial Day 2012: Let’s work for peace as we remember the wars of the past
May 28, 2012
In remembering the service men and women who have fought in wars, President Barack Obama issued a proclamation calling on the people of the United States to observe Memorial Day as a day of prayer for permanent peace.
Obama designated 11 a.m. today as a time to unite in prayer. He also asked all Americans to observe in their own way the National Moment of Remembrance at 3 p.m. local time on Memorial Day.
